Structural engineer services involve assessing and analyzing the structural integrity of buildings and other structures. These professionals evaluate existing conditions, identify potential weaknesses, and provide detailed plans or recommendations to ensure safety and stability. Their work often includes reviewing architectural and engineering drawings, conducting on-site inspections, and performing calculations to determine whether a structure can support intended loads or if modifications are necessary. This service is essential during new construction, renovations, or repairs to confirm that structures meet safety standards and comply with local building codes.

These services help address a variety of problems related to structural safety and durability. For example, they can identify signs of foundation settlement, structural cracks, or material deterioration that might compromise a building’s stability. Structural engineers also assist in resolving issues caused by environmental factors such as soil movement or water damage. By providing expert assessments, they help property owners avoid costly failures and ensure that repairs or reinforcements are properly designed and implemented.

Property types that typically utilize structural engineering services include residential buildings, commercial properties, industrial facilities, and institutional structures. Homes undergoing significant renovations, such as basement conversions or additions, often require structural evaluations to support new loads or modifications. Commercial buildings, such as office complexes or retail centers, depend on structural assessments to maintain safety during upgrades or expansions. Industrial facilities, which may involve heavy machinery or specialized equipment, also benefit from these services to verify that existing structures can handle operational demands.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cuyahoga County,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Design Consultation Fees - Structural engineering design consultations typically range from $100 to $300 per hour, with total costs depending on project complexity. For small residential assessments, costs may be around $500, while larger commercial projects can exceed $2,000.

Structural Analysis Costs - Conducting a detailed structural analysis gener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Simple evaluations for a single-family home might be closer to $1,200, whereas more extensive analyses for commercial buildings can reach $5,000 or more.

Inspection Service Charges - Structural inspections usually cost between $200 and $600, depending on the size and scope of the property. A typical home inspection may be around $300, while larger or more complex structures could be higher.

Design Modification Fees - Modifications to structural plans often fall within the $500 to $2,000 range, based on the extent of changes needed. Minor revisions may cost less, while significant redesigns for large projects can be more costly.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is the role of a structural engineer? A structural engineer assesses and designs the framework of buildings and structures to ensure safety and stability.

When should I hire a structural engineer? A structural engineer should be contacted for foundation issues, remodeling projects, or any structural modifications to ensure safety and compliance.

How do structural engineers work with contractors? Structural engineers provide plans and specifications that contractors use to properly construct or modify structures according to safety standards.

What types of structures do structural engineers evaluate? They evaluate a variety of structures including residential, commercial, and industrial buildings, as well as bridges and other infrastructure.
